CZ 512 22LR - 15 round magazine

 

Fully DIY 15 round magazine.
Tested and working flawlessly with my CZ 515 Tactical.

 

Should also work with:

  • CZ452, CZ453, CZ455, CZ457 & CZ512
  • Brno Models 1, 2 & 5
  • Cogswell & Harrison Certus
  • Norinco JW15 & JW25
  • Lithgow Crossover LA101
    (May have to change/file/alter the magazine follower - don't have any of these rifles, so can't test)

0.8mm diameter spring wire, wound around the printable spring jig works well.
Wind it around into the grooves, then use pliers/multi-grips and squeeze each coil flat against the sides of the jig.
Once flattened, wind back off the jig.
With your fingers, pinch each coil and straighten the spring as best as possible (it doesn't need to be perfect)
Anneal the spring in your oven - 260 degrees Celsius or 500 degrees Fahrenheit for approx 2 hours (the spring will change colour)

 

PLA+ works well.
